  <common-name>Linuron</common-name>
  <description>Linuron is an herbicide for the pre- and post-emergence control of annual grass and broad-leaved weeds using selective and systemic action with contact and residual action. It is known to inhibit photosynthesis (photosystem II).</description>

  <mechanism-of-toxicity>Linuron is a weak competitive inhibitor of androgen receptor binding and it inhibits androgen-induced gene expression in vitro. This may partially contribute to the malformations of androgen-dependent tissues in male rats. (A9961)</mechanism-of-toxicity>

  <health-effects>Linuron affects the male reproductive system of the offspring after maternal exposure during mid and late pregnancy.</health-effects>
